Customer Business Lead

FMCG - Non - Food
📍 Hybrid – 2 days connected - Berkshire
C.£105,000 + car + bonus + package

The opportunity:

This is a high-profile commercial leadership opportunity with responsibility for one of the business's most strategically important retail customers.

Reporting to the Sales Director – Retail, you will lead the customer strategy across the UK, driving profitable growth, strengthening customer partnerships and delivering the commercial agenda across a complex retail environment.

What will my key accountabilities be?

  • Own the overall commercial relationship with a major UK retail customer, acting as the senior point of contact.
  • Develop and deliver the annual customer business plan and commercial strategy.
  • Use customer, category and market insight to shape the joint business agenda.
  • Lead, coach and develop a high-performing customer team.
  • Work cross-functionally to ensure excellent execution against customer plans.
  • Own customer P&L performance, commercial investment and forecasting.

A great candidate will have:

We are looking for an experienced commercial leader who combines strong customer management skills with genuine strategic and commercial thinking.

You'll ideally bring:

  • Significant experience managing major UK retail customers within FMCG, consumer goods or a related environment.
  • A proven track record of delivering profitable customer and category growth.
  • Strong commercial negotiation and influencing skills.
  • Experience building senior-level customer relationships and strategic partnerships.
  • Experience leading and developing high-performing teams.
  • Strong analytical and numerical capability, with the ability to turn insight into action.
  • The confidence to operate within a complex, matrix organisation and influence across functions.
  • A collaborative, entrepreneurial and solutions-focused mindset.
  • The ability to combine strategic thinking with strong commercial execution.

In return for everything you can bring, the business can offer you:

  • Car
  • Bonus scheme – up to 28%
  • Private Medical Insurance
  • Pension Plan 6% employee/ 12% employer
  • 25 days holiday + bank holidays
